New cigar boutique seeks one-night mobile-unit permit; board offers guidance but no formal vote
Summary
Resident Karen Pitt asked the board for a one-night mobile-unit location and permission to hold a grand-opening event for a new boutique cigar shop at 2640 Joey's Plaza. The board discussed parking placement and indicated no formal vote was required for the one-time request.

Resident Karen Pitt, who identified herself and gave her address, told the board she has opened a boutique cigar retail store at 2640 Joey's Plaza and requested permission to have a mobile unit and entertainment for a one-night grand opening. She said the store will be retail only (no lounge), selling five Nicaraguan blends and operating as a cash-and-carry business.
Board members discussed placement in the parking lot so traffic would not be impeded and confirmed neighbors had been contacted. The chair and code enforcement officer said no formal presentation or vote was required for the one-time request and encouraged the applicant to coordinate with neighbors and the barber and other plaza tenants. The board welcomed the new business and wished the applicant luck.
